What is an E-Learning Developer job?

An E-Learning Developer is responsible for designing, developing, and implementing online learning materials and courses. They use instructional design principles, multimedia tools, and e-learning software to create engaging and interactive content. Their role often involves collaborating with subject matter experts, graphic designers, and other stakeholders to ensure effective learning experiences. Additionally, they may be responsible for maintaining and updating e-learning content to keep it relevant and accessible.

What Does an eLearning Developer Do?

As an eLearning developer, you design and implement the structure of online courses using eLearning tools, such as instructional software and applications. You take the blueprint for the course, including content that has been created by an instructional developer, and design and code the lessons. Your duties and responsibilities are to make the lessons visually appealing and engaging while effectively conveying the lessons to students or users. As an eLearning developer, you may work for an education company or a company that designs instructional tools and solutions for employee training.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the E Learning Developer position, and why are they important?

To thrive as an E Learning Developer, you need expertise in instructional design, multimedia creation, and a solid understanding of adult learning principles, typically supported by a relevant degree like instructional technology or education. Familiarity with Learning Management Systems (LMS) such as Moodle or Canvas, authoring tools like Articulate Storyline or Adobe Captivate, and experience with SCORM or xAPI standards are highly valuable. Strong project management, creative problem-solving, and effective communication skills help you collaborate and translate complex subjects into engaging online content. These competencies are critical for creating high-quality, impactful learning experiences that meet organizational and learner goals.

What are some common challenges E Learning Developers face in this role?

E Learning Developers often encounter challenges such as adapting content to suit diverse learners, ensuring accessibility compliance, and keeping up with rapidly evolving educational technologies. They may need to collaborate closely with subject matter experts who have varying levels of familiarity with digital tools, making clear communication essential. Managing tight project deadlines while maintaining high engagement and interactivity standards can also be demanding. However, overcoming these common challenges can be highly rewarding, as it directly contributes to the effectiveness and reach of educational programs.
